OpenAI founder Altman said the company will not go public this year and he does
not expect an IPO in 2026, saying substantial safety work remains. His comments
follow an Anthropic employee resignation and stern warning about AI
capabilities. Markets had anticipated large IPOs from OpenAI and Anthropic this
year; Altman’s statement shifts near-term IPO timing pressure onto Anthropic CEO
Dario Amodei, who on Saturday urged a slowdown in AI development.
